comparemela.com
Home
St Petersburg Dog Club
Top Locations Tagged with St Petersburg Dog Club
St Petersburg Dog Club in India - 395009/Supermarket near Surat
1). Dog Club Pet Shop
vimarsana © 2020. All Rights Reserved.